Leila has reached the age of 63 years. The residency of Leila is at 138 Willoughby Oaks Blvd, Saltillo, Ms 38866. Leila's birth date was listed as 1961. Tupelo and Ecru are cities Leila has lived in. Phone number listed for Leila is (662) 869-2476.